How much do I need to start a manicure and pedicure business?

Starting a manicure and pedicure business can be a lucrative endeavor, but it does require some capital investment. Here is a breakdown of what you need to get started:

Business License and Insurance

The first thing you need to do is to get your business license and insurance. This will vary depending on your location, so be sure to check with your local government office for more information.

Manicure and Pedicure Equipment

You will need to purchase some basic equipment, such as a manicure table, pedicure chair, and sterilization system. You can find these items at a variety of retailers, both online and offline.

Products

You will also need to stock up on products, such as nail polish, lotion, and foot baths. You can purchase these products from a variety of retailers, or you may want to consider wholesaling them.

advertising

You will also need to invest in some advertising to let people know about your new business. This can include everything from online ads to fliers and brochures.

How do I start a small nail business?

Starting a small nail business can be a fun and profitable venture, but it takes a lot of hard work and planning to get started. Here are some tips on how to get your business off the ground.

First, you’ll need to decide what services you want to offer. Nail services can include everything from basic manicures and pedicures to more complex procedures like acrylic nails and nail art. You’ll also need to decide what type of customer you want to target. Are you looking to cater to busy professionals who want a quick and easy manicure, or do you want to focus on young women who are interested in elaborate nail designs?

Once you’ve decided on your services and target market, it’s time to start planning your business. You’ll need to create a business plan, which will include information on your target market, your competitive analysis, your marketing strategy, and your financial projections. You’ll also need to get a business license and insurance, and set up a business bank account.

Next, you’ll need to set up a workspace. This can be anything from a small home office to a dedicated salon space. If you’re working from home, you’ll need to buy or rent equipment and supplies, and you’ll need to make sure you have enough space to accommodate your clients. If you’re renting a salon space, you’ll need to make sure it’s properly equipped and licensed.

Once your business is up and running, you’ll need to market your services and attract new clients. You can do this through online and print advertising, word-of-mouth marketing, social media, and networking with other local businesses.

How do I start a pedicure?

A pedicure is a treatment for the feet that typically includes soaking the feet in a bath of water, a scrub, a mask, and a moisturizer. Pedicures are usually performed by a professional, but they can also be done at home.

If you’re looking to get a pedicure done at home, the first step is to gather the necessary supplies. This includes a basin or bucket large enough to fit your feet, warm water, soap, a scrub brush or pumice stone, a mask, a moisturizer, and nail clippers and a file.

The next step is to soak your feet in the warm water. This will help soften the skin and make it easier to remove any dead skin cells. Add a small amount of soap to the water to help further clean the feet.

Then, use the scrub brush or pumice stone to gently scrub the feet, paying special attention to the heels and the balls of the feet. Be careful not to scrub too hard, as this can cause irritation.

Next, apply the mask. Leave it on for the recommended amount of time, then rinse it off.

Finally, apply the moisturizer. Be sure to apply it evenly to the entire foot, including the heels and the balls of the feet.

Once you’ve finished, use the nail clippers and file to trim and shape your nails. Be sure to clip and file in the same direction to avoid splitting the nails.

What do you need for a nail business?

Opening a nail business can be a lucrative endeavor, but there are a few things you‘ll need before you can get started. First, you’ll need to decide on the services you want to offer. You’ll need to decide on a name for your business, and you’ll need to get a license and insurance. You’ll also need to purchase some equipment and materials. Here’s a closer look at what you‘ll need to get your nail business off the ground.

Services

The services you offer will largely depend on the type of business you want to create. If you’re looking to open a traditional nail salon, you’ll need to offer services such as manicures, pedicures, and nail extensions. If you’re looking to start a mobile nail business, you may want to offer services such as nail art, gel nails, and acrylic nails. You’ll also need to decide on a pricing structure, and you’ll need to create a menu of services.

Name

Choosing a name for your nail business can be tricky. You’ll want to choose a name that is catchy and memorable, but you’ll also want to make sure that the name is legally available. You can check to see if a name is available by doing a trademark search.

License and Insurance

In order to open a nail business, you’ll need to obtain a business license from your local government. You’ll also need to obtain liability insurance. This insurance will protect you in the event that a customer is injured while visiting your salon.

Equipment and Materials

There are a few pieces of equipment that are essential for a nail business. You’ll need a manicure table, a pedicure chair, and a drying station. You’ll also need to purchase a variety of nail polish colors, nail polish remover, and other supplies.
